Filter press automation—replacing manual operation with PLC control, automated valves and pumps, and remote monitoring—transforms filter press operation into a continuous, optimized, data-driven process. PLC Control Architecture
The PLC receives inputs from pressure sensors (feed, filtrate, hydraulic), level sensors (slurry tank, filtrate tank), position sensors (plate position, cylinder), and flow meters. Outputs control feed pumps (VFD), hydraulic system, valves (feed/filtrate/wash/air blow), and cloth washing. The PLC executes the cycle: plate closing, feeding, filtration, air blow, cake wash, plate opening, cake discharge, cloth washing.
Cycle Optimization
The PLC continuously adjusts feed pressure (maximizing rate without exceeding cloth rating), detects end-of-filtration from filtrate flow decline, and optimizes air blow duration. For membrane presses, membrane inflation pressure and timing maximize cake solids. Optimization algorithms are rule-based (if-then) or model-based.
Remote Monitoring
PLC communicates with SCADA via Modbus TCP, OPC UA, or Profinet. The SCADA provides real-time visualization, historical logging, alarm management, and remote control. Qingdao Britop systems integrate with existing plant SCADA or provide standalone web-based HMI.
Predictive Maintenance
Vibration monitoring detects pump bearing wear. Hydraulic pressure trends indicate seal wear. Cloth blinding is detected from increasing filtration time or decreasing filtrate flow. Maintenance alerts enable scheduled rather than reactive repairs.
Energy Optimization
VFDs on feed pumps reduce energy compared to throttling. Automated cycles minimize idle time. Motor control center monitoring provides energy efficiency data.
Safety Interlocks
Overpressure protection, position sensors preventing movement during discharge, emergency stops. PLC logs all safety events.
Upstream/Downstream Integration
Level control links thickeners/clarifiers to filter press. Interlocks link to cake conveyors and dryers for continuous material flow.
